Yesterday two of the last second leg matches of the UEFA Champions League were played, and nine participants of the most popular football news portal in Lithuania compete until the end of the season for the title of the best oracle. The exact result of the London "Arsenal" and "Monaco" match was predicted by two tournament participants. These are commentators Aurimas Budraitis and Paulius Jakelis. Other participants also predicted the winner, while Mantas Katleris and Tomas Langvinis, who bet on a draw, remained without points. Meanwhile, only one member of the Lithuanian national team, Donatas Kazlauskas, predicted the exact result of the Madrid "Atletico" and Leverkusen "Bayer" match. The remaining participants, except for Tomas Langvinis, predicted the winner. Rules: 4 points are awarded to a participant for correctly predicting the result. 2 points are awarded for correctly predicting the goal difference. If the participant correctly predicts the winner of the match, they receive 1 point. Participants who do not correctly predict the winner will not receive any points. Tournament table: 1. The first matches between the teams playing today were intense, but neither club is yet certain of their qualification to the quarter-finals. "Barcelona" will host "Manchester City" at home. Almost all participants of "Star Wars" are convinced that the Catalans will once again defeat the English champions and confidently advance to the next stage. However, Paulius Jakelis predicts a stunning victory for "Man City" and the exit of "Barça" from the Old Continent tournament. Meanwhile, five participants believe that Dortmund's "Borussia" will defeat Turin's "Juventus" at home, three predict a draw, and only Aurimas Budraitis is confident in a minimal victory for the "Bianconeri" team.
